Function FICO_DIFF_GET_HELP pattern details

In-order to call this FM within your sap programs, simply using the below ABAP pattern details to trigger the function call...or see the full ABAP code listing at the end of this article. You can simply cut and paste this code into your ABAP progrom as it is, including variable declarations.
CALL FUNCTION 'FICO_DIFF_GET_HELP'"
EXPORTING
I_S_DIFFCATG = "Structure for Differentiation Categories Table and Text
* I_LISTTYPE = "Condition group type (list type)
* I_LANGU = SY-LANGU "SAP R/3 System, Current Language

IMPORTING
E_TAB_DIFF_HELP = "Table with Differentiation Values
E_RC = "Return Value, Return Value After ABAP Statements
E_T_RETURN = "Return Table
.



IMPORTING Parameters details for FICO_DIFF_GET_HELP

I_S_DIFFCATG - Structure for Differentiation Categories Table and Text

Data type: FICOS_DIFFCATG_1
Optional: No
Call by Reference: Yes

I_LISTTYPE - Condition group type (list type)

Data type: FICOT_LIST-O_LISTTYPE
Optional: Yes
Call by Reference: Yes

I_LANGU - SAP R/3 System, Current Language

Data type: SYLANGU
Default: SY-LANGU
Optional: Yes
Call by Reference: Yes

EXPORTING Parameters details for FICO_DIFF_GET_HELP

E_TAB_DIFF_HELP - Table with Differentiation Values

Data type: FICO_TYP_TAB_DIFF_HELP
Optional: No
Call by Reference: Yes

E_RC - Return Value, Return Value After ABAP Statements

Data type: SY-SUBRC
Optional: No
Call by Reference: Yes

E_T_RETURN - Return Table

Data type: BAPIRET2_T
Optional: No
Call by Reference: Yes
